Erratic driver collides with police vehicle…

PRINCE GEORGE, BC: One man has been arrested following an incident with an erratic driver early this morning…

Police say at 7:45 AM on February 22, 2021, the Prince George RCMP received a report that a motorhome had collided with a North District Traffic Services police vehicle near 5th Avenue and Central Street West.

“The North District member received no serious injury and continued to follow the motorhome, which was driving erratically on the road and would not stop when the member activated his emergency lights. The North District member then contacted Prince George RCMP frontline officers for assistance in stopping the erratic driver,” states Cst. Jennifer Cooper of the Prince George RCMP.

The driver continued to Haldi Lake Road, where he collided with a pickup truck at the intersection of Haldi Lake Road and Highway 16 West. The driver of the pickup truck was not seriously injured.

The motorhome finally stopped at an address on the 9000 block of Haldi Lake Road. The driver attempted to flee when police arrived on scene but was ultimately arrested and transported to the Prince George RCMP detachment where he will remain until he can attend court. Emergency Health Services transported the female passenger of the motorhome to hospital for treatment of her injuries.

Police will be forwarding charges of flight from police, resist arrest and dangerous operation of a motor vehicle to the B.C. Prosecution Service for charge assessment.

Police will also investigate the status of the driver’s license at the time of the offence as they are familiar with the driver.
